Ginger MATRIS® and MINIACTIVES®: taste masking and reduced gastric sensitivity through advanced microencapsulation

Introduction

Ginger (Zingiber officinale) is a widely used ingredient in the nutraceutical sector due to its well-known digestive, antioxidant, and gastrointestinal-support properties. It is traditionally included in formulations aimed at digestive health, nausea management, inflammation control, and overall well-being.

Despite its recognized benefits, the formulation of ginger presents several challenges, particularly related to its intense organoleptic profile and potential gastric sensitivity, especially at higher dosages or in sensitive individuals.

In this context, IPS has developed solutions based on proprietary and patented MATRIS® and MINIACTIVES® technologies, designed to improve sensory acceptance and modulate the interaction of the active ingredient with the gastrointestinal tract.

 

Properties and application fields of ginger

Ginger offers multiple nutraceutical applications:

  • Digestive support
    Traditionally used to promote digestion and gastrointestinal comfort.
  • Nausea management
    Included in nutritional protocols to help reduce nausea and gastric discomfort.
  • Antioxidant activity
    Rich in bioactive compounds such as gingerols and shogaols.
  • General gastrointestinal wellness
    Used in formulations aimed at supporting digestive functionality.

 

Formulation challenges of ginger

The use of ginger in nutraceutical formulations is limited by:

  • Strong taste and pungency, difficult to mask
  • Potential gastric irritation or sensitivity
  • Variability in sensory perception depending on concentration
  • Negative impact on consumer compliance

These aspects highlight the need for a technological approach capable of improving both tolerability and acceptability.

 

IPS innovation: Ginger MATRIS® and Ginger MINIACTIVES®

IPS has developed two complementary technological approaches:

Ginger MATRIS®

Based on direct microencapsulation of the active ingredient using proprietary and patented MATRIS® technology, it provides:

  • Effective taste masking, reducing pungency and organoleptic impact
  • Reduced gastric sensitivity
  • Improved gastrointestinal tolerability
  • Release modulation without altering the nature of the active ingredient
Ginger MINIACTIVES®

Based on proprietary MINIACTIVES® technology, it enables:

  • Controlled and modulated release
  • Improved distribution of the active ingredient
  • Greater formulation uniformity
  • Flexibility to adapt to different dosage requirements

 

Scientific evidence

IPS technologies are supported by scientific evidence:

  • MATRIS® technology: preclinical studies conducted on advanced in vitro 3D models and human intestinal and gastric organoids demonstrate improved tolerability, reduced impact on gastric membranes, and better interaction with the intestinal epithelium.
  • MINIACTIVES® technology: clinical studies conducted on Coenzyme Q10 and Citicoline MINIACTIVES® show improved release profile, bioaccessibility, and tolerability.

Although these studies were not conducted directly on ginger, the results confirm that the observed benefits are attributable to the technologies themselves, which represent the key factor influencing the behavior of microencapsulated active ingredients.
